Giter Club home page Giter Club logo

Comments (8)

IHateMyKite avatar IHateMyKite commented on August 13, 2024 1

Hi, can't see anything wrong from this. Its possibly caused by race condition. Can you please try to get the CTD with following version so I get more info ? Only difference is that it have enabled logging. Note that it will dump big amount of data, so the performance might get worse.
IWant Widgets NG 1.2.3 - Loggin.zip

from iwantwidgetsng.

IHateMyKite avatar IHateMyKite commented on August 13, 2024 1

Looks like some kind of race condition. Can you try this version ?
IWant Widgets NG 1.2.4 Exp.zip This one should apply spinlock from UI class. If it will not work, then I will release additional version which serialize certain function so no race condition can happen. Issue with that would be that there will be lag between function call and its application.

from iwantwidgetsng.

IHateMyKite avatar IHateMyKite commented on August 13, 2024

Sorry, the files I uploaded didn't contain the updated binary with enabled logging. Please try this instead. you can then find the log in same folder as other SKSE mods.
IWant Widgets NG 1.2.3 - Loggin.zip

from iwantwidgetsng.

AndrejAndb avatar AndrejAndb commented on August 13, 2024

thank you.
Not sure how fast I can reproduce it... too random (it happens that everything is fine for a few days, but sometimes 1-5 CTD in a hour)

"race condition' - actually very likely - problems usually (but not always) in the midst of a battle or other intense activity

from iwantwidgetsng.

AndrejAndb avatar AndrejAndb commented on August 13, 2024

I don't know why, but after I started using the debug version, I can't repeat the crashes. to make sure - I'll try the regular version (I don't know how the logging is working - maybe it adds a mutex for write to logfile)

from iwantwidgetsng.

AndrejAndb avatar AndrejAndb commented on August 13, 2024

crash-2023-11-04-11-43-17.log
IWantWidgetsNative.log
Papyrus.0.log

the crash log is a little different, I'm not sure if it is related

from iwantwidgetsng.

AndrejAndb avatar AndrejAndb commented on August 13, 2024

crash-2023-11-22-20-34-24.log
(+- identical as previous crash log)


reproduced twice. I was install additional mods with few widgets - think it is related


(it seems I managed to compile, I'll try to study and analyze)

from iwantwidgetsng.

AndrejAndb avatar AndrejAndb commented on August 13, 2024

I now had a problem that CTD repeated constantly, but after activate LOGGING - crashes miraculously stopped. (re-disabling logging - crashes appeared again)

I want to rework logging a bit and test some things

from iwantwidgetsng.

Related Issues (1)

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. 📊📈🎉

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google ❤️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.